Sandblaster - I wasn't trying to be derogatory about the 'elderly' but I know as I get close to 60, that I am not as sharp as I was at 30, 40 or 50 - age takes its toll physically and mentally no matter how well you look after yourself.

I know that I would have been tired at midnight having been up for most of the day - he may well have had a nap to stave off the fatigue (I use those regularly) and was completely 100% and ready to when he got airborne - fatigue and age might not have been a factor in this tragedy but they can't be discounted out of hand just because he was a fine chap with an up to date physical.

I was more concerned by the nature of his departure - low level over trees going from light to dark - doesn't sound like someone at the top of their game.
